"I think the interesting thing about Rothko to me is that while he was very career conscious, very protective of his work, that nevertheless his passion and devotion to his work went way beyond career or anything else. And maybe the way he protected his work was as a result of his consciousness, you know, that he'll achieve something special. At any rate, I never thought of him as compromising in any way his work for the sake of career, or making work just to influence career. If there were two sides to him, I would say, if you wanted to make a distinction between self and ego-his self went into his work and his ego went into his career. But he didn't mix it up as far as his work went."
- Jack Tworkov
